Chemical Structure and Physical Quality

Salt silicates are readily available in both solid and liquid kinds, with the general formula Na โ‚‚ O ยท nSiO โ‚‚, where “n” signifies the molar proportion of SiO two to Na two O, commonly referred to as the “modulus.” This modulus considerably affects the compound’s solubility, thickness, and sensitivity. Higher modulus worths correspond to enhanced silica content, bring about greater firmness and chemical resistance yet reduced solubility. Salt silicate services display gel-forming behavior under acidic conditions, making them optimal for applications needing regulated setup or binding. Its non-flammable nature, high pH, and ability to form dense, protective films better enhance its energy popular settings.

Role in Construction and Cementitious Materials

In the construction market, sodium silicate is extensively made use of as a concrete hardener, dustproofer, and sealing representative. When applied to concrete surfaces, it reacts with complimentary calcium hydroxide to develop calcium silicate hydrate (CSH), which compresses the surface, boosts abrasion resistance, and decreases permeability. It likewise acts as an effective binder in geopolymer concrete, an appealing choice to Rose city cement that substantially reduces carbon discharges. Additionally, salt silicate-based grouts are utilized in underground engineering for dirt stablizing and groundwater control, offering cost-effective remedies for facilities strength.

Applications in Factory and Steel Casting

The factory industry counts greatly on salt silicate as a binder for sand mold and mildews and cores. Compared to typical organic binders, sodium silicate offers remarkable dimensional precision, low gas evolution, and ease of recovering sand after casting. CO two gassing or organic ester treating techniques are typically made use of to establish the salt silicate-bound mold and mildews, offering quick and trustworthy manufacturing cycles. Recent developments concentrate on boosting the collapsibility and reusability of these molds, minimizing waste, and enhancing sustainability in steel casting operations.

Use in Cleaning Agents and Family Products

Historically, sodium silicate was a crucial active ingredient in powdered washing cleaning agents, functioning as a home builder to soften water by withdrawing calcium and magnesium ions. Although its usage has actually declined somewhat due to environmental problems connected to eutrophication, it still contributes in industrial and institutional cleansing formulations. In green cleaning agent advancement, researchers are exploring modified silicates that stabilize performance with biodegradability, straightening with global fads towards greener consumer items.

Environmental and Agricultural Applications

Beyond commercial uses, salt silicate is obtaining traction in environmental protection and agriculture. In wastewater treatment, it assists remove hefty steels via precipitation and coagulation processes. In farming, it acts as a soil conditioner and plant nutrient, specifically for rice and sugarcane, where silica reinforces cell walls and improves resistance to pests and illness. It is additionally being checked for usage in carbon mineralization projects, where it can react with CO two to develop secure carbonate minerals, adding to long-term carbon sequestration techniques.
